Before I was afflicted I went astray: but now have I kept thy word. Psalm 119:67
It is good for me that I have been afflicted; that I might learn thy statutes. Psalm 119:71
I know, O Lord…that thou in faithfulness hast afflicted me. Psalm 119:75

George Goodman wrote “Affliction is testing at the hand of God, our faithful Father in heaven. To affliction we bow in submission”. We see in our first verse that God uses affliction for our correction. Then in the second, we see that through affliction He gives us counsel. In the third, we see the kindness of God in affliction. We have His faithful consolation. —Pete Smith

Faint not, nor fear; His arm is near.
He changeth not and thou art dear. —John Monsell
